VK GAMING Clinches Apex Legends Title at Esports World Cup 2025

Brazil’s VK GAMING claimed the Apex Legends tournament at the Esports World Cup 2025 after a strong and steadily rising performance that secured first place and a top prize of $600,000. The tournament brought together elite teams from around the world in one of the most competitive battle royale games.

 Saudi Arabia’s ROC Esports secured second place, capping an impressive run marked by top-tier gameplay that earned the team a $300,000 prize, further cementing the growing presence of Saudi teams on the global esports stage.

 Ninjas in Pyjamas came in third, taking home $200,000, while Gen.G Esports finished fourth with a prize of $150,000.

 VK GAMING officials praised the team’s tactical discipline and collective spirit, highlighting the weeks of focused training and detailed preparation that culminated in the championship. They credited the victory to strategic insights into the play styles of competing teams.

 Apex Legends is one of the world’s leading battle royale titles, with a global player base exceeding 130 million since its release. Its competitive edge and balanced gameplay mechanics have made it a staple in professional esports tournaments.

 Alongside the matches, the tournament offered an immersive entertainment and cultural experience featuring live music performances, anime cafés, retro gaming zones, content creator studios, and cosplay showcases—delivering a comprehensive interactive environment for esports fans of all ages.
